    Im coming to Disney in a week and didn't realize I should have made reservations already for restaurants. Everytime I go to make a reservation it says its booked. Can you still go and wait in line or are the restaurants reservations only?

    Welcome to the Disney Parks Moms Panel Melissa!

    All is not lost. We often go to Disney without any Advanced Dining Reservations (ADRs) and play it by ear so don't lose hope just yet. Here are some suggestions:

    * Keep trying. You can do that by calling 407-WDW-DINE every day or so as guests often cancel reservations once they get closer to their trips and firm up their plans. You can also continue to check online. Sometimes I've had more luck by calling. Continue to check even after you arrive on property.

    * If you want to dine at a Table Service location inside a theme park, stop by Guest Relations on your way in to check for availability.

    * One other option is to try walking up. This option may not be great if you have little ones who may not understand if you can't get in and be truly disappointed but you never know if you don't try. We've had good success if we try just before they start serving and ask. Locations that offer buffets can often turn tables over more quickly so these may be good locations to try.

    * Think outside the theme parks and try restaurants at the resorts.

    * Don't stress if you can't get in. There are still great places to eat where reservations aren't required. Be Our Guest Restaurant in the Magic Kingdom is Quick Service for lunch and doesn't accept reservations so this is a fabulous option.
